Transaction 3737a105ec31980fdfa802fc41bf2064f4e977ed1aac185112268fb19fafe762
1 Input
1 Outputs
- 3737a105ec31980fdfa802fc41bf2064f4e977ed1aac185112268fb19fafe762:0
value 838075
address 15RMjSdfnGT82ZKui5JFwGQBZvwqQT8UGH